Sandpipers, Snipes and Phalaropes (Scolopacidae)
Greater Yellowlegs (Tringa melanoleuca) - HBW 3, p. 511
French: Grand Chevalier
German: Großer Gelbschenkel
Spanish: Archibebe Patigualdo Grande
Taxonomy: Scolopax melanoleuca Gmelin, 1789, Chateaux Bay, Labrador.
Monotypic.
Distribution: S Alaska and British Columbia E to Labrador, Newfoundland I, Anticosti I and NE Nova Scotia. Winters from British Columbia and the Carolinas through Mexico, Central America and West Indies to South America, S to Tierra del Fuego.
